Most people travel to Uruguay for its gorgeous and tranquil beaches. Few people know about the extensive rolling hills that fill the countryside. These are landscapes with rounded hills and low mountain ranges that are ~500-600 million years-old. Sheep, cows, goats, llamas, ostriches, armadillos, donkeys and horses stroll the land as they live their lives in this beautiful and unspoiled countryside. Vineyards and olive groves adorn the long, long views. Native trees sparkle the hills and shelter local fauna. The scent of native flowers and the mellow sound of streams provide a place for appreciation and contemplation of Pueblo Edén, an 83-soul community nestled in this gorgeous setting.

Susanne Tabet to niemiecka współczesna malarka abstrakcyjna, która mieszka i pracuje w Falls Church w Wirginii. Samouk zaczęła malować mając dwadzieścia kilka lat, kiedy wizyta w Tate Modern w Londynie rozbudziła jej pragnienie odtworzenia charakterystycznych abstrakcyjnych kobiecych portretów Amedeo Modiglianiego. Kontynuowała naukę i eksplorację dzieł innych wielkich mistrzów w dziedzinie abstrakcyjnego ekspresjonizmu, a przez lata rozwijała i ewoluowała swoje umiejętności i charakterystyczny styl osobisty. Koncentruje się na kobiecej formie, którą ożywia kontrastowymi kolorami i odważnymi, energicznymi pociągnięciami pędzla. Jej portrety emanują siłą i wrażliwością.
